I am trying to perform some capacity planning for some of our
residential pops, but the old calcs I used to use seem useless -- as
they were adapted from the dialup days and relied upon a percentage of
users online (~50%) and a percentage of concurrent transmission (~19%).
My present scenario involves a micro-pop terminating 250 residences
where users are expecting 4 mb/s. So I am looking for some baseline to
begin at, so I am wondering what others are doing.
